A green roof or living roof is a roof of a building that is partially or completely covered with vegetation and a growing medium planted over a waterproofing membrane it may also include additional layers such as a root barrier and drainage and irrigation systems.

A structural engineer s advice is essential to ensure comprehensive design development based on the building s construction condition and weight loading capacity.
Proper selection of agriculturally durable materials structural engineering design and review and responsible water handling should all be considered to achieve maximum energy efficiency and perhaps leed recognition.
The load bearing capacity of a building must be known before planning a green roof wall or facade.
